hexoprenaline and Preterm Birth

hexoprenaline has been researched along with Preterm Birth in 3 studies

Hexoprenaline: Stimulant of adrenergic beta 2 receptors. It is used as a bronchodilator, antiasthmatic agent, and tocolytic agent.
